Swamp Cypress - Taxodium distichum

Bald Cypress is a striking deciduous conifer known for its soft feathery foliage, strong upright form, and dramatic seasonal colour. Exceptionally adaptable, it thrives in both wet and dry conditions while delivering timeless landscape presence.


🌱 Why Gardeners Love Bald Cypress

Soft, feathery foliage - Creates a light, elegant canopy with fine texture.
Spectacular autumn colour - Turns rich copper and russet tones before leaf drop.
Thrives in wet soils - Perfect for flood-prone, low-lying, or poorly drained areas.
Strong architectural form - Develops into a tall, stately feature tree.
Long-lived and resilient - Valued for durability and long-term landscape impact.


🏡 How to Use Bald Cypress in Your Garden

Feature tree planting - Creates a commanding focal point in large gardens.
Wet or swampy areas - Ideal for ponds, waterways, and low drainage zones.
Avenue planting - Delivers an impressive, uniform look when planted in rows.
Park and estate landscapes - Perfect for expansive, long-term landscape designs.


Easy Planting & Care Guide

  • Spacing: Allow 6 to 8m between trees for feature planting. For avenue planting, consistent spacing creates maximum visual impact, so purchasing multiple trees together is recommended.

  • Best Planting Time: Can be planted year-round, best season is autumn or winter.

  • Mulching & Fertilising: This tree establishes naturally and does not require mulching or fertiliser to remain healthy.


❔ FAQs About Bald Cypress

Is Bald Cypress suitable for wet or swampy areas?
Yes, it thrives in wet soils and is one of the best trees for flood-prone sites.

Does Taxodium distichum lose its leaves in winter?
Yes, it is deciduous and regrows fresh foliage each spring.

How large does Bald Cypress grow?
It matures into a large, tall tree ideal for feature and landscape planting.

Is Bald Cypress difficult to maintain?
No, it is very low maintenance once established.

Is Bald Cypress a good long-term landscape tree?
Yes, it is highly valued for longevity, strength, and seasonal beauty.
